The Farm Market

The Farm Market 250 Jackson Street, Lowell

The Farm Market operates year-round indoors at Mill No. 5, a destination for community gathering. The market emphasizes a direct connection between producer and consumer with the purpose of supporting local food producers, building the local food economy, and increasing food access. Event Series Lowell Chess Club

Lowell Chess Club

The Parlor 250 Jackson St, Lowell

Everyone is welcome! We have some strong regulars, and some less experienced players. Come join us - there's an opponent for everybody! We play on Sunday afternoons from 1 to 5 p.m. at Mill No. 5 in The Parlor (just down the corridor from Coffee and Cotton)
